....nterest on the refund, another contention was raised that since the correct amount of interest on refund was not granted on time, therefore, they are entitled to interest on interest. The learned Commissioner (Appeals) has decided this issue against the assessee on the ground that there is no provision under the Income Tax Act, 1961, for providing interest on interest.
